Does WSUS tell whether a Windows update has been installed right after it deploys updates to a PC, or does it have to wait until the PC checks in again to tell if the updates deployed were installed?

You need to wait until the machine reports again.
It has to wait until the computer has checked in again. Depending on how often you have your systems checking ing, you will typically see that Approved updates will show as "Downloaded" and then "Pending Reboot." Once the computer has installed the update(s), rebooted, and checked in again, the update will no longer appear as being required. If the update has an error, you'll see in the WSUS console that the update has an error.
And if you have Windows Updates set up in Group Policy, you know the exact time at which the clients will check in. Double that with a GPP that forces your computers to shut down or reboot at a given time every evening and you can have dependable WSUS strategy throughout your network.
